What You’ll Need: Basic Cross-Stitch Supplies
Before you thread your needle, let’s gather the essentials:
Embroidery hoop – Keeps your fabric taut and easier to work with.
Aida cloth (14-count is beginner-friendly) – The most common fabric for cross-stitch, with a grid-like weave that’s easy to count.
Embroidery floss – Cotton thread, typically DMC brand. You’ll usually separate strands depending on your pattern.
Embroidery needle – Look for blunt-tip tapestry needles in size 24 or 26.
Scissors – Small, sharp embroidery scissors will make your life easier.

Understanding the Basics
Cross-stitch is made up of tiny X-shaped stitches that follow a counted pattern. Think of it like pixel art, but on fabric.
Here’s how it works:
Start at the center of your fabric and pattern to ensure it’s centered.
Thread your needle with 2 strands of floss.
Make a diagonal stitch ( / ), then cross it in the opposite direction ( \ ) to form an X.
Repeat following the chart—one square on the pattern = one stitch on the fabric.
Pro Tips for First-Time Stitchers
Wash your hands before stitching—oils from skin can discolor your fabric.
Avoid knots—secure threads by weaving them under previous stitches on the back.
Use a needle minder or magnetic board to keep your tools organized.
Take breaks—cross-stitch is relaxing, not a race.
Embrace imperfection—every stitcher makes mistakes. Your piece is still beautiful.
